Gyakie Makes History as First African Woman to Join Spotify’s EQUAL Initiative

Ghanaian soul and Afro-fusion artist Gyakie (Jacqueline Acheampong) has achieved a significant milestone, becoming the first African woman to partner with the global audio streaming platform, Spotify, for its EQUAL initiative.
Gyakie was selected for the inaugural class of the EQUAL program, which is dedicated to fostering equity for women in music globally. This achievement earned her a coveted feature on a Times Square billboard in New York City.

The artist expressed her gratitude on social media:
“I am deeply honored to be the first African woman to partner with @Spotify for Equal. This is huge for so many women across the continent and the entire globe. I don’t take this lightly at all…”
The EQUAL initiative aims to amplify the voices of women in music worldwide, addressing the stark disparity where only one in five artists on the charts are women
